As of September 2026, Cordova At Spanish Wells in Bonita Springs, FL has 2 homes for sale. Over the 12 months ending 2026-09-12, 8 recorded sales closed at a median of $946,500, $432 per square foot, a median 40 days on market, sellers accepting 94% of original asking (-3% versus the prior year). At the median price and Lee County's FY2025-26 rate of 15.97 mills, annual property tax runs about $15,120 ($14,450 with the full homestead exemption).

Cordova At Spanish Wells is a large-home, low-turnover corner of Bonita Springs — 207 homes with a median living area over 4,100 square feet and a median year built of 2015. That combination of size and newer construction is what drives the median price to $913,000 and the price per square foot to $428.88; this is a build-quality and square-footage story more than a scarcity story.

Only seven closings fed the current window, so the -6.8% year-over-year change should be read as a signal from a thin sample, not a firm trend line. A median 47 days on market and a market heat score of 42 point to a market that is moving at a measured pace — sellers who price to condition and size are transacting, but nothing here suggests urgency or bidding pressure.

Size, vintage, and a thin resale pool

The homes here skew large and comparatively newer for the area, with a build range from 1980 to 2019 and a median year built of 2015 — meaning the resale pool leans toward homes built well after the community's start. At a median of 4,181 square feet, buyers here are typically shopping for space first, which is reflected directly in the $913,000 median price and the $428.88 per-square-foot figure.

A homestead share of 64.9% suggests a meaningful portion of these homes are owner-occupied on a longer-term basis rather than cycled as investment or seasonal inventory, which helps explain why closings are limited (seven in the current window) and why days on market run into the high 40s. With a market heat score of 42, this is not a fast-moving segment — sellers should expect a deliberate search process from buyers evaluating square footage and finish quality against the price per foot, not a rush of comparable offers.
